Cleanroom Robots in Healthcare Market Analysis of Applications in Pharma and Medical Devices
The global healthcare and life sciences industry is experiencing a major transformation driven by robotic automation in healthcare, the rapid evolution of pharmaceutical robotics market trends, and increasing deployment of medical device manufacturing robots. These technologies are redefining precision, efficiency, and contamination control across critical healthcare environments.
The global Cleanroom Robots in Healthcare Market was valued at USD 665.33 million in 2024 and is projected to reach USD 833.66 million in 2025. It is further expected to grow to USD 6,461.58 million by 2034, registering a CAGR of 25.5% during the forecast period (2025–2034).

Cleanroom robots are designed to operate in highly controlled environments where air quality, particle levels, and contamination risks are strictly regulated. These robots perform tasks such as material handling, filling, packaging, and inspection without compromising sterility.
Healthcare manufacturers are increasingly adopting robotic systems to meet stringent regulatory requirements while improving efficiency and scalability.
Market Segmentation and Key Insights
The Cleanroom Robots in Healthcare Market is segmented based on type, application, and end user.
By Type
- Articulated robots dominate due to their flexibility and precision
- SCARA robots are widely used for assembly and pick-and-place operations
- Collaborative robots (cobots) are gaining traction in shared work environments
By Application
- Pharmaceutical manufacturing leads due to high sterility requirements
- Medical device production is rapidly growing
- Biotechnology research and laboratory automation are expanding segments
By End User
- Pharmaceutical companies represent the largest share
- Medical device manufacturers are rapidly adopting cleanroom automation
- Research laboratories and contract manufacturing organizations (CMOs) are increasing usage
